What You’ll Do:
- Develop and implement Behavior Intervention Plans (BIPs) based on Functional Behavior Assessments (FBAs)
- Provide direct and consultative behavioral support to students, teachers, and support staff
-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to support IEP development and implementation
- Model effective behavioral strategies and provide coaching to staff
- Track progress, maintain documentation, and participate in IEP or student support meetings
- Respond to student crises and assist with de-escalation techniques when needed

Requirements:
- Bachelor's or Master’s degree in Behavior Analysis, Psychology, Education, or related field
- BCBA certification preferred (or RBT with relevant school-based experience)
- Minimum 2 years of experience in a school setting supporting students with behavioral challenges
- Strong understanding of FBAs, BIPs, and data-driven behavior support
- Excellent collaboration, communication, and problem-solving skills
- Must be available for the 2025–2026 school year and able to work on-site in Clermont, FL
